Tx Carrier
State
TXO=
1 byte, 0 thru 9
Command or Query.
Sets or returns Tx Carrier State in the form x, where:
0=OFF due to front panel or remote control command
1=ON
2=RTI (receive/transmit inhibit), timeout=10 seconds
3=OFF due to ext H/W Tx Carrier- Off control *
4=OFF due to BUC or High-Stability Ref warm-up *
5=Carrier controlled by STDMA Controller *
6=RTI (receive/transmit inhibit), timeout=1 second
7=RTI (receive/transmit inhibit), timeout=2 seconds
8=RTI (receive/transmit inhibit), timeout=4 seconds
9=RTI (receive/transmit inhibit), timeout=7 seconds
NOTE: Arguments indicated with a * are status-only. They are not valid as a command, and are not indicated in MGC?
response.
EXAMPLE: <0/TXO=1 (Tx Carrier ON)

Tx Alpha
TXA=
1 byte, 0 thru 5
Command or Query.
Sets or returns Tx Alpha Filter Rolloff Factor in the form x, where:
0=0.35
1=0.25
2=0.20
3=0.15
4=0.10
5=0.05
EXAMPLE: <0/TXA=0 (Tx filter rolloff factor is 0.35)

Power Level
Mode
(was AUPC
Enable)
AUP=
1 byte, 0 thru 3
Command or Query.
Sets or returns Power Level Mode in the form x, where:
0=MANUAL mode (AUPC disabled) – Normal power mode
1=AUPC enabled.
2=MANUAL-LOW – Low power mode (-65 to -20dBm) - external attenuator activated.
3=AUPC-LOW – AUPC enabled and external attenuator activated
EXAMPLE: <0/AUP=1 (AUPC Enabled)
NOTES:
1) EDMAC or D&I++, E1 D&I w/ccs or ESC++ framing must be selected for the AUPC feature to be available.
2) External 20dB Attenuator is a hardware option.

AUPC
Parameters
APP=
6 bytes
Command or Query.
Sets or returns AUPC operating parameters in the form abc.cd, where:
a=Action on max. power condition: (0=do nothing, 1=generate Tx alarm)
b=Action on remote demod unlock: (0=go to nominal power, 1=go to max power)
c.c=Target Eb/No value, in dB, for remote demod from 0.0 thru 14.9:
Numbers above 9.9 use hex representation for the first character, i.e. 14.9 is coded as E.9.
d =Max increase in Tx Power permitted, in dB, from 0.0 thru 9.0
EXAMPLE: <0/APP=015.67 (Sets no alarm, max power, 5.6 dB Target and 7 dB power increase.)
